Resumo
The overarching objective of this research is to investigate the interrelationships that highlight parities and differences between a selection of works by artist José Leonilson and images from the film “Paris, Texas” (1984), by Wim Wenders. Considering the tropes of displacement and the element of the desert, the tension of poetic and aesthetic parallels between the artists aims to elaborate dialogues arising from the narrowing of images produced through different languages. By assuming the difficulty of achieving explanations that take into account the dimension of speech, the investigation proposes to think about the conflict between what is said and what is left unsaid, based on the provocations of the essay “The aesthetics of silence” (Sontag, 1963), in a reflection that locates the developments of these aspects present in art (language, introspection and silence) to a social degree.
